About 5 Chatsworth Avenue
5 Chatsworth Avenue is a four-bedroom semi-detached house in Warton, Preston, Preston (PR4 1BQ). It has a recorded floor area of 74 m² (around 797 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(October 2014) shows an E (score 41),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 77),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from October 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
At 74 m² it's 19.6%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(92 m² median across 16 EPCs). It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 81% of similar EPCs). Across 2015–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 10%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£291,000 is 17.3%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£311/sq ft) was about 102.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: September 2021 at £248,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
